< návrat zpět
MS Excel
Téma: VBA_posun-řádek-sloupec
Zaslal/a jnkopr 3.9.2019 14:36
Dobrý den, prosím vás o nakopnutí, jak vyřeším toto zadání. Potřebuji z jednoho sloupce přesunout/zkopírovat vybrané hodnoty v řádcích do jiného sloupce a ještě o řádek níže. Pro názornost přikládám příklad. Velice děkuji za pomoc.
Příloha: 44126_posun_radek_sloupec.zip (14kB, staženo 21x)
Sub posun_radek_sloupec()
Dim RNG As Range, Bunka As Range, Pocet As Long
Application.ScreenUpdating = False
For Each Bunka In Columns("D:D").SpecialCells(xlCellTypeBlanks).Offset(0, -1).Cells
Bunka.Copy Bunka.Offset(-Pocet, -1)
Pocet = Pocet + 1
If Pocet = 1 Then Set RNG = Bunka.Resize(, 2) Else Set RNG = Union(RNG, Bunka.Resize(, 2))
Next Bunka
RNG.Delete Shift:=xlShiftUp
Application.ScreenUpdating = True
End Subcitovat
jnkopr(4.9.2019 7:35)#044140 Zdravím,mockrát děkuji,excelentní řešení.
citovat